Why was the freedmens bureau established by congress during Southern reconstruction?

Social Studies
1 answer:
Len [333]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

b. To help former slaves to get food, shelter, clothing and education.

Explanation:

The southern reconstruction is a period when the former-slaves that freed during the civil war tried to transitioned to citizenship.

At that time, many southern people still openly treat the former-slave horribly. They attack them when they're out at nights, not hiring them for any types of jobs, etc.

This made it really difficult for the formers slaves to survive. The Freedmen's bureau was established to help them. As one of their programs, the Bureau help former slaves to get food, shelter, clothing and education.

<span>This feeling of detachment is known as anomie. Émile Durkheim identified anomie as a form of breakdown of the bonds between an individual and his society, so that society does not provide him with functional moral guidance. The Kitty Genovese case may be an example of urban anomie, since social bonds did not function to prompt her neighbors to alert police.</span>
